Ian B. (') said:Can anyone recommend something to lubricate my chain that;
1) Goes on easily for a chain that can be taken off the bike
2) Lasts a fair amount of time and is reasonable all weather
Finish Line Cross Country. I've recently let my LBS persuade me to try
White Lightning Epic, but it isn't nearly as good. Stick to Finish Line.
Quoted message said:3) Is not overly expensive
You don't use much. Really. A little bottle may cost about five quid but
it lasts a very long time. I prefer the dropper bottle to the spray can
- you don't waste so much.
